Arby's Will Begin Serving Up a Pumpkin Pie Turnover This September

Following in the footsteps of other QSRs, Arby's has just unveiled a new seasonal fall offering: the perfectly spiced new Pumpkin Pie Turnover.

Perfect for pumpkin lovers who have made had enough of pumpkin spice lattes, Arby's new Pumpkin Pie Turnover is bursting with familiar seasonal flavors. The seasonal treat combines a classic flaky turnover pastry with a creamy, generously spiced pumpkin pie filling. The flaky pastry is then drizzled with a sweet icing glaze on top to add an extra touch of sweetness.

If you're ready to get your hands on the new Pumpkin Pie Turnover, there's just one catch. Unlike many other brands, Arby's is waiting until fall officially arrives to debut this treat, which means you won't see it until September 30, 2024.
